How to verify a developer's escrow account compliance in Dubai Hills

5Answers
McTimothy
04/15/2026, 07:20:22 AM

In Dubai, all off-plan project sales require developers to maintain a RERA-regulated escrow account. To verify a developer's escrow compliance for a project in Dubai Hills, start by obtaining the account number from the developer’s sales office. Then, visit the Dubai Land Department (DLD) website or use the 'Dubai REST' app. Enter the project or escrow account details. The system will confirm if the account is active, RERA-approved, and reflects all transactions transparently. This step is a non-negotiable part of safeguarding your investment in the UAE.

For practical verification, request the Escrow Account Certificate directly from the developer; reputable firms in Dubai will provide it willingly. Cross-reference this document on the official RERA website under the 'Project Search' feature. Ensure the account's registered name exactly matches the developer's trade license and that Dubai Hills is listed as the project location. Finally, contact the appointed escrow agent or bank trustee, whose details are public, for verbal confirmation. This multi-step check is crucial for any expat buyer in the UAE to ensure funds are fully protected.

Beyond basic verification, understand the implications. A compliant escrow account in Dubai ensures your stage payments are released to the developer only against certified construction milestones, as verified by the project's trustee. Non-compliance carries severe penalties for developers, including license suspension. How does a British expat family in Abu Dhabi choose between IB and British schools

Choosing between IB and British schools in Abu Dhabi hinges on your child's future plans and learning style. The International Baccalaureate (IB) offers a globally-focused, inquiry-based curriculum, ideal for families who may relocate again or target universities worldwide. British schools follow the structured National Curriculum for England, leading to GCSEs and A-Levels, providing familiarity and a direct path to UK higher education. For a British family planning a long-term stay in the UAE or a eventual return to the UK, the British system often feels like a seamless extension of home.
